AI Processing, Exploitation, and Dissemination Laboratory
MIT Lincoln Laboratory
The Artificial Intelligence (AI) Processing, Exploitation, and Dissemination (PED) Laboratory is a software integration facility in which researchers can apply machine learning to the automation of processes that transform raw data into usable information.

Air Traffic Control Automation & Aviation Weather Decision Support Laboratories
MIT Lincoln Laboratory
Lincoln Laboratory staff use the Air Traffic Control (ATC) Automation and Aviation Weather Decision Support Laboratories to test prototype systems for air traffic control and to collect weather data that will help inform improvements to flight safety.
